Bessie Harvey
American, 1928-1994

Figure with Beaded Headdress, ca. 1980
Plastic beads, metal, paint, and putty on tree root

Figure with Hair, ca. 1980
Plastic beads, hair, paint, and putty on tree root.

Purchase with funds from T. Marshall Hahn, Jr., and
Lucinda W. Bunnen for the Nasisse Collection, 1993.96

Bessie Harvey added plastic beads, hair, and glass
eyes to guarded tree branches and roots. Her haunting
sculptures reflect the spirits residing in nature and
look back to the origins of the African American
experience. Harvey, who lived in Tennessee, says
"nature shapes my works."
